Installation
1. Curb Stone
A. Layout
1. Set the layout for curb stones according to the approved plan, ensuring that
lines and grades are followed.
B. Base Course Preparation
1. Compact the base course to achieve sufficient compaction before its final
placement.
C. Setting Curb Stones
1. Set curbs in a full bed of mortar to ensure stability and resistance to lateral
forces exerted by adjacent elevated interlocking blocks.
2. Maintain a minimum 10mm spacing between curb stones, and fill the joints
with mortar to ensure a strong bond between adjoining curbs.
2. Interlocking Blocks
A. Subgrade Preparation
1. Prepare the subgrade for interlocking block installation by removing soft soils
that could create an unstable foundation.
B. Protection
1. Protect the finished work from damage until substantial completion.
C. Debris Removal
1. At the end of each workday, remove rubbish and debris resulting from this work
from the site.
